Listen to The Soil’s New Song ‘Korobela’

South African acapella soul group The Soil have a new single. Titled "Korobela," the heartwarming love song talks about loving someone to a point where you feel like you are under the spell of a love potion.


Some of the lyrics are tongue-in-cheek, and they help drive the point home about love and relationships.
